Handover note — Crumbwheel order cutoffs.

Welcome aboard. The bakery cutoff rule in Crumbwheel closes same-day orders at 14:00 local to each storefront, not UTC — this has bitten us twice. Holiday overrides live in the calendar service and take precedence silently, so always check there first when a cutoff looks wrong. To unlock the calendar service's admin console after a restart, enter the recovery passphrase below.

vault phrase of bagap-bahaf = silion-pelox-sorox-casdor-quenwyn-fraax-eliox-praael-kelion-quenvan-kasox-rusael-norius-belvan

## Investigate cron drift in Quillbase schedulers

This PR addresses the drift we saw on the Quillbase nightly jobs, where runs slipped by several minutes over a week. Root cause: the scheduler recomputed next-run times from the previous actual start rather than the wall-clock anchor. I've switched to anchored scheduling and added jitter bounds so hosts don't stampede. If you're new to this codebase, the scheduler module is the only touch point. The corrected timing parameters are listed below.

tuning table, faduf-baduf:
PRIORITIES = {
    "ulavan": 191,
    "silys": 750,
    "goriel": 238,
    "kelmir": 66,
    "wendor": 432,
}

**Ticket: Canary gate rejecting builds — signature check failing**

Heads up for folks new to the Lintbarrow pipeline: the canary gate verifies every artifact before it counts toward promotion rules. Last night's builds failed because they were signed with the rotated-out key. Re-sign and re-push — the gate accepts the current key only, shown here:

deploy key for yajop-fahop: bky3_h1v

### 2.9.4 — Key rotation

Quick one for the security review: we rotated the signing key for the Tillworth payments service after the flaky integration tests turned out to be a stale-credential issue, not a timing bug. The old key expired mid-suite, which explains the random failures everyone blamed on the sandbox. Tests are green for five straight runs now. New artifacts from this release onward verify against the key below.

deploy key for yagap-kawig: bky4_Q8dK